
Tossing Coins for a Dollar
For this assignment, you will create a game program using the Coin class from
When the game begins, your starting balance is $0. During each round of the game, the program will toss the simulated coins. When a coin is tossed, the value of the coin is added to your balance if it lands heads-up. For example, if the quarter lands heads-up, 25 cents is added to your balance. Nothing is added to your balance for coins that land tails-up. The game is over when your balance reaches $1 or more. If your balance is exactly $1, you win the game. You lose if your balance exceeds $1.
